Otter-Autograder

An autograding system for teaching, primarily focused on Canvas LMS integration. Supports automated grading of programming assignments (via Docker), text submissions (like learning logs), quizzes, and manual exam grading with AI assistance.

Installation

pip install Otter-Autograder

Quick Start

1. Set up Canvas API credentials

Create a .env file in your working directory:

CANVAS_API_KEY=your_canvas_api_key_here
CANVAS_API_URL=https://your-institution.instructure.com

2. Create a grading configuration

Create a YAML file (e.g., assignments.yaml) defining your courses and assignments:

assignment_types:
  programming:
    kind: ProgrammingAssignment
    grader: template-grader
    settings:
      base_image_name: "your-docker-image"

courses:
  - name: "Your Course"
    id: 12345
    assignment_groups:
      - type: programming
        assignments:
          - id: 67890
            repo_path: "PA1"

3. Run the grader

grade-assignments --yaml assignments.yaml

Features

Supported Assignment Types

  • Programming Assignments: Docker-based grading with template matching and test execution
  • Text Submissions: AI-powered grading with rubric generation and clustering analysis
  • Quizzes: Canvas quiz grading support
  • Exams: Manual grading with AI-assisted name extraction and handwriting recognition
  • Web-based Grading UI: Modern interface for problem-first exam grading

Key Capabilities

  • Parallel execution with configurable worker threads
  • Automatic score scaling to Canvas points
  • Slack notifications for grading errors
  • Record retention for audit trails
  • Regrade support for existing submissions
  • Test mode for validation before full grading runs

Usage Examples

Grade with limited submissions (testing)

grade-assignments --yaml config.yaml --limit 5

Regrade existing submissions

grade-assignments --yaml config.yaml --regrade

Test submissions without pushing grades

grade-assignments --yaml config.yaml --test

Control parallelism

grade-assignments --yaml config.yaml --max_workers 2

Requirements

  • Python >= 3.12
  • Docker (for programming assignment grading)
  • Canvas API access
  • Optional: OpenAI or Anthropic API keys for AI-powered features
